OpenSea is the first and largest peer-to-peer marketplace for cryptogoods (like an eBay for crypto assets), which include collectibles, gaming items, and other virtual goods backed by a blockchain. On OpenSea, anyone can buy or sell these items through a smart contract. The OpenSea team has backgrounds from Stanford, Palantir, and Google, and is funded by YCombinator, Founders Fund, Coinbase Ventures, 1Confirmation, and Blockchain Capital.

OpenSea is the first and largest marketplace forĀ non-fungible tokens, or NFTs. Applications for NFTs include collectibles, gaming items, domain names, digital art, and many other items backed by a blockchain. OpenSea is an open, inclusive web3 platform, where individuals can come to explore NFTs and connect with each other to purchase and sell NFTs. What You'll Do:

    • Help scale, architect, and implement our next-generation storage infrastructure including but not limited to using Postgres, Dynamo, Redis, and Elasticsearch
    • Work closely with product engineering teams in advancing their critical initiatives
    • Support data in transient and event streaming infrastructure and define paved paths
    • Mentor and train other team members

Desired Skills:

    • Designed and operated large-scale Postgres databases that support millions of users and a high volume of transactions
    • Excited to dive deep into database specifics to diagnose and resolve scalability bottlenecks
    • Ability to apply a world-class understanding of storage architecture to critical product initiatives
    • Passion for teaching and mentoring high-growth engineers
    • Proficiency with at least one programming language, preferably Python
    • Full working experience with other distributed systems at scale (e.g. event streaming, DynamoDB, ElasticSearch) is a plus
